Girls’s Historical past Month is upon us. The Girls’s Historical past Month celebrations originated in 1981, with Congress requesting the President to name the week starting March 7, 1982 “Girls’s Historical past Week.”
Congress continued to cross resolutions calling per week in March “Girls’s Historical past Week” for the following 5 years.
Following a petition from the Nationwide Girls’s Historical past Venture, Congress designated the entire month of March 1987 as “Girls’s Historical past Month.” Congress continued to cross resolutions between 1988 and 1994 asking and authorizing the President to proclaim March of every yr as Girls’s Historical past Month.
Since 1995, presidents have made annual proclamations designating the month as “Girls’s Historical past Month.” These typically have a good time the contributions girls have made to the U.S. and the methods they’ve achieved varied feats by American historical past.
